Maine state trooper injured after cruiser rear-ended, hits vehicle he pulled over during traffic stop

A Maine state trooper is recovering after he was rear-ended by another vehicle during a highway traffic stop on Saturday night, authorities said. The cruiser that Trooper Patrick Flanagan was in spun around and hit the vehicle he had pulled over. Violent clashes over quota system in government jobs leave scores injured in Bangladesh

DHAKA – Police fired tear gas and charged with batons during violent clashes between a pro-government student body and student protesters overnight, leaving dozens injured at a public university outside Bangladesh’s capital, police and students said Tuesday.
